Moog is looking for an Electrical Product Engineering Manager to lead the Electrical Product Engineer team for Commercial Aircraft in East Aurora NY. In this role, you will organize, allocate, direct and motivate the resources of this group to provide high quality engineering work. The product engineering team is responsible for development and sustainment of the build and test of Moog designed products.

Moog Aircraft Group is the leader of advanced flight controls for commercial aircraft. We are positioned on virtually every aircraft in the marketplace, supplying reliable systems that are highly supportable and add significant value for our customers. Moog designs, manufactures and integrates precision motion control components and systems. Our high-performance solutions are used in satellites and space vehicles, military and commercial aircraft, launch vehicles, missiles, industrial machinery, marine applications, and medical equipment.

As an Electrical Product Engineering Manager, you will...

  • Lead and manage the product engineering staff matrixed across concurrent development programs.

  • Manage a collaborative innovation environment to challenging development objectives.

  • Perform a variety of direct employee management and supervisory functions including hiring, training, allocating resources, supervision, and growing highly skilled technical personnel through on-going performance and development reviews.

  • Be responsible for resource management to EVMS schedules.

  • Identify strategic and budgetary control opportunities relating to engineering estimates, development lifecycle performance, and outstanding development risk to schedule and cost performance.

  • Lead engineering process development through maturation of process standards, templates, specifications, and automation to increase the process consistency, replicability, and efficiency.

  • Monitor first pass yield for both build and test, working with the teams to drive for increased efficiency.

  • Monitor non-conformance performance, working with the teams to reduce defects.

  • Work with supply chain to understand product transitions and provide support.

  • Monitor electronic obsolescence of production programs and perform zero date calculations and execute last time buys.

  • Travel 10% domestically and/or internationally.
